Fender pots

Fender pots A Fender potentiometer, commonly referred to as a "pot," is a variable resistor used in Fender guitars and amplifiers to control volume, tone, or other parameters. These pots are essential components of the electronic circuits within Fender instruments and amplifiers. They typically consist of a resistive element connected to a rotating shaft, which adjusts the resistance as the shaft is turned. This, in turn, alters the voltage or current flowing through the circuit, thereby affecting the volume or tone of the instrument. Fender pots come in different values and types to suit various applications and player preferences. They're crucial for fine-tuning the sound and playability of Fender guitars and amps.
